Communication is key to having a healthy relationship. However, sometimes we simply don’t have time to sit down and carry on a conversation with our lover. Sometimes life is simply to hectic and schedules don’t match up. There are ways to communicate with your lover and I will explain three ways you can do just that.
Email Your Lover
You may have just laughed at that healthy relationship tip, but it is a great way to communicate with your lover. If you work with a computer, email is a great way to communicate with your lover. You can type him or her an email while you are on break. Doing this a few times a week will keep you two in contact with one another.
Skype, Facetime, or Video Messages
If you work out of town, work long hours, or your lover is never home when you are, consider using Skype, Facetime, or recording a video message on your phone. This is a great way to communicate when the two of you are super busy and aren’t in the same room with each other long enough to have a conversation.
Write Your Lover a Letter
Don’t throw out the old fashion way of communicating with people just yet. If you and your lover are on different schedules, or don’t get to see each other often, write your lover a letter. A hand written letter is a great way to communicate. Leave the letter by his or her pillow when you leave so they will see it when they go to bed or wake up.
Having a healthy relationship is important and when communication isn’t there, it can put a strain on the relationship. So, use these relationship tips to help bridge the gap when it comes to communication.
